Harper broke out of his hitless slump to begin the 2024 season in a major way on Tuesday night. Following an 0-for-11 start in Philadelphia's first three games, Harper hit two home runs in his first two at-bats against the Reds.
If you watched Iowa's 94-87 win over LSU in the Elite Eight on Monday night, you weren't alone. Per ESPN, an astounding 12.3 million people tuned into the second regional final in Albany, N.Y., breaking the record for most viewers of a women's basketball game in television history.

The second round goes to the Hawkeyes. Iowa avenged last year's national title game loss to LSU with a 94-87 win in the Elite Eight on Monday night. The Hawkeyes advance to their second consecutive Final Four and third in program history.
